Trajectories of Anxiety and Depression in Cancer Patients, Risk and Predictive Factors and Supportive Care; Prognostic Awareness and Shared Decision Making.

Summary
To examine the trajectories of anxiety and depression symptoms over the course of oncological disease, and to assess potential predictors-sociodemographic (age, sex, marital status, employment status), clinical (tumor location, stage, treatment type, general health), psychological (coping strategies, quality of life, cognitive difficulties, fear of recurrence), and physical activity-and their association with support needs and utilization of psychosocial services.
Detailed description
The study population consists of consecutive oncology patients recruited across multiple centers, with data collection occurring at baseline (diagnosis or treatment initiation) and at 3-month and 6-month follow-up time points.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| OTHER | Psychosocial and clinical assessment | Participants complete standardized self-report questionnaires and undergo medical record review at three time points (baseline, 3 months, and 6 months) to assess psychological symptoms (anxiety, depression, somatization), coping strategies, quality of life, cognitive difficulties, physical activity, nutrition, supportive care needs, and informed decision-making in the context of cancer treatment. No experimental treatment or therapy is administered. |
